Overview
STI76NF75 from STMicroelectronics is an N-channel 75 V, 9.5 mΩ typ. (11 mΩ max), 80 A Power MOSFET fabricated using STripFET II technology, optimized for high-efficiency isolated DC-DC converters in telecom and computing systems, with 100% avalanche testing and exceptional dv/dt capability up to 12 V/ns.
For engineers reviewing the STI76NF75 datasheet, STI76NF75 pinout, STI76NF75 application, or STI76NF75 equivalent, key selection criteria include RDS(on) at 10 V gate drive, total gate charge (117–160 nC), avalanche energy rating (700 mJ), thermal resistance (RthJC = 0.5 °C/W), and TO-220/D²PAK package compatibility for high-power switching layouts.
Technical Context
This device operates as a primary-side hard-switched or resonant-mode power switch in offline SMPS and telecom DC-DC converters. Its low Qg (117–160 nC) and minimized Ciss (3700 pF) reduce driver losses and improve switching efficiency at 100–500 kHz frequencies.
The integrated source-drain diode supports synchronous rectification and unclamped inductive switching, with trr = 132 ns and Qrr = 660 nC at TJ = 150 °C - critical for ZVS/ZCS topologies requiring controlled reverse recovery behavior.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VDSS | 75 V - Maximum blocking voltage for primary-side switch in ≤48 V input telecom supplies or 24–48 V industrial bus architectures. |
| RDS(on) max | 11 mΩ at VGS = 10 V, ID = 40 A - Enables ≤0.35 W conduction loss at 60 A continuous drain current in thermally managed designs. |
| Qg | 117–160 nC - Determines gate driver power requirement and switching speed; compatible with standard 1–2 A peak gate drivers. |
| EAS | 700 mJ - Confirmed single-pulse avalanche robustness supports reliable operation under transient overvoltage or inductive kick events. |
| dv/dt | 12 V/ns - High immunity to false turn-on during fast voltage transients in high-noise power stage environments. |
| RthJC | 0.5 °C/W - Enables 300 W dissipation at ≤150 °C junction temperature with minimal heatsink interface resistance. |
Pinout & Package
STI76NF75 is available in TO-220 (STP76NF75) and D²PAK (STB76NF75) packages. Pin assignments are identical across variants: Pin 1 = Gate, Pin 2 = Drain (Tab), Pin 3 = Source.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| Pin 1 (G) | Gate terminal | Controls channel conduction; requires 10 V drive for full enhancement; gate capacitance (Ciss = 3700 pF) dominates Miller effect in hard-switched topologies. |
| Pin 2 (D / Tab) | Drain connection / thermal pad | High-current drain path and primary thermal interface; metal tab must be electrically isolated and thermally coupled to heatsink. |
| Pin 3 (S) | Source terminal | Reference node for gate drive and current sensing; low-inductance layout essential to minimize shoot-through risk during switching transitions. |

FAQ
Is STI76NF75 pin-compatible with STP76NF75 and STB76NF75?
Yes - STI76NF75 shares identical pinout (G-D-S) and electrical specifications with STP76NF75 (TO-220) and STB76NF75 (D²PAK). The STI76NF75 order code was removed in DS5399 Rev 3 (Jan 2026), but legacy devices remain functionally identical and interchangeable in layout and circuit design.
What is the maximum continuous drain current at 100 °C case temperature?
The maximum continuous drain current is 70 A at TC = 100 °C, as specified in Table 1 of DS5399. This derating reflects thermal limits under sustained conduction; pulsed current capability remains 320 A (IDM) with appropriate SOA compliance.
Does STI76NF75 support gate drive voltages below 10 V?
Yes - gate threshold voltage (VGS(th)) ranges from 2 V to 4 V, enabling partial enhancement at 5 V drive. However, full RDS(on) specification (9.5 mΩ typ.) applies only at VGS = 10 V; operation below 8 V increases on-resistance nonlinearly and reduces safe operating area margins.
How is the 700 mJ avalanche energy measured and validated?
EAS = 700 mJ is measured per JEDEC JESD24-11: starting at TJ = 25 °C, ID = 40 A, VDD = 37.5 V, with unclamped inductive switching. Each production lot undergoes 100% avalanche testing - not sample-based - ensuring every device meets this energy rating before shipment.
